Speaker of Shura Council Discusses Parliamentary Cooperation with Speaker of Turkish Grand National Assembly
Istanbul, April 17 (QNA) - HE Speaker of the Shura Council, Hassan bin Abdullah Al Ghanim met Friday with HE Speaker of the Grand National Assembly of Turkiye Professor Numan Kurtulmus, on the sidelines of the 152nd Assembly of the Inter-Parliamentary Union (IPU), currently being held in Istanbul.
Discussions during the meeting dealt with bilateral parliamentary cooperation relations between the two sides and ways to strengthen and develop them in a manner that serves common interests.
They also discussed the most prominent topics on the IPU Assembly's agenda and exchanged views on them, particularly regarding the emergency item submitted by the State of Qatar, represented by the Shura Council, and a number of other countries, with the support of geopolitical groups within the IPU.
Both sides emphasized the importance of supporting the emergency item submitted by the State of Qatar, given its role in contributing to the consolidation of international peace and security, promoting a ceasefire, and strengthening international efforts aimed at containing conflicts.
HE the Speaker of the Grand National Assembly of Turkiye also praised the strength of the Qatari-Turkish relations. (QNA)
